Edge computing Technology in Import and Export Trade: Real time Data Processing and Localization Decision

introduction

Traditional import and export trade relies on cloud based centralized data processing, but scenarios such as cross-border logistics and customs inspections require real-time decision-making with low latency and high reliability. Edge computing, by sinking its computing power to the edge of the network (such as ports, warehouses, transport vehicles), realizes data localization and rapid response, and becomes a key technology for the digital transformation of the import and export industry. This paper will analyze the core application, technical architecture and future trend of edge computing in import and export trade.


1、 Core application scenarios of edge computing in import and export trade

Real time scheduling of intelligent ports

The port needs to coordinate ship berthing, container loading and unloading and truck transportation. edge computing can reduce cloud communication delay:

Automated crane control: Deploy edge servers locally on the crane to process real-time camera and sensor data, automatically adjust the position and force of the lifting equipment. The "Smart Port" project of Shanghai Yangshan Port improves container handling efficiency by 30% through edge computing, while reducing the demand for cloud bandwidth by 80%.

Dynamic path planning: Combining GPS and edge AI models to plan the optimal route for trucks in real-time and avoid congested road sections. The 'Edge Logistics' platform at Dubai's Jebel Ali Port has reduced truck waiting times from 2 hours to 15 minutes.

Cross border cold chain monitoring

Fresh food, medicine and other goods are sensitive to temperature, and edge computing can realize localized anomaly detection and automatic intervention:

Intelligent temperature controlled container: Install edge devices (such as NVIDIA Jetson) inside the container to analyze temperature, humidity, and carbon dioxide data in real-time. If the threshold is exceeded, the edge device can automatically start the refrigerator or send an alarm. Maersk's "Remote Container Management" system reduces the risk of cold chain fracture by 50% through edge computing.

Drug transportation verification: FDA requires continuous temperature records for drug transportation, and edge devices can generate tamper proof electronic certificates (such as blockchain certificates) to meet compliance requirements.

Automated Customs Inspection

The customs needs to quickly identify high-risk goods, and edge computing can support localized image recognition and risk assessment:

AI inspection robot: Deploy edge servers at the customs site to process real-time X-ray scanning images and automatically identify prohibited items (such as drugs and weapons). The "Smart Gate" system of Dubai Customs in the United Arab Emirates compresses the inspection time from 30 minutes to 5 minutes through edge computing.

Document OCR recognition: Deploy edge devices in the customs declaration hall to quickly extract key information from customs declarations and compare it with local databases, reducing cloud communication latency. The "single window" edge nodes of Chinese customs have processed over 100 million documents with an accuracy rate of 99.9%.

2、 Technical architecture and key components of edge computing

Edge device layer

Select different types of devices according to the requirements of the scenario:

Industrial edge gateway: supports industrial protocols such as Modbus and OPC UA, connecting sensors and PLC devices. Siemens' SIMATIC IPC series edge gateways have been applied in over 500 ports worldwide.

Intelligent camera: Integrated with AI chips (such as Huawei Ascend 310), it can locally run models such as object detection and behavior analysis. Hikvision's "DeepInMind" camera has been deployed along the China Europe freight train to achieve automatic inventory of goods.

Vehicle mounted edge server: provides computing power for transportation vehicles, supports real-time navigation, fault diagnosis, and fleet management. Tesla's "Full Self Driving Computer" is essentially an on-board edge computing platform that processes camera and radar data to achieve automatic driving.

Edge network layer

5G private network: Provides low latency (<10ms) and high bandwidth (>1Gbps) communication capabilities, supporting real-time control of port automation equipment and drones. The 5G private network of Hamburg Port in Germany has covered 20 square kilometers and supports simultaneous access of over 1000 edge devices.

LPWAN (Low Power Wide Area Network): Suitable for edge devices in remote areas such as border monitoring stations, representative technologies include LoRaWAN and NB IoT.
